Israeli flotilla activist released under conditions as foreign participants deported
An Ashkelon court barred Zohar Regev from entering Gaza for 60 days after police sought a 184-day ban
Assessment
Israel has begun processing the participants in the latest flotilla attempt. An Ashkelon court imposed a two month Gaza entry ban on an Israeli activist, while foreign participants are being deported. The outcome sets a legal precedent for how the state manages future maritime protests against the blockade.
